What is Melatonin?

Melatonin, often referred to as the “sleep hormone,” is a naturally occurring substance produced by the brain’s pineal gland in response to darkness. Its secretion follows a cyclical pattern, aligned with the body’s internal clock, known as the circadian rhythm. This rhythm regulates various physiological processes, including the sleep-wake cycle.

At night, as darkness descends, melatonin levels rise, signaling to the body that it’s time to wind down and prepare for sleep. Conversely, in the presence of light, melatonin production diminishes, promoting wakefulness and alertness during the day.

While melatonin is primarily recognized for its role in regulating sleep, it also exerts influence over other bodily functions, including immune response and antioxidant activity. Its multifaceted nature makes melatonin a key player in maintaining overall health and well-being.

In supplement form, melatonin is commonly used to address sleep disturbances, such as insomnia or jet lag, by helping to regulate the sleep-wake cycle. Available in various formulations and dosages, melatonin supplements offer a convenient option for individuals seeking to optimize their sleep quality and duration.

However, it’s essential to recognize that melatonin supplementation is not a one-size-fits-all solution. Factors such as individual response, underlying health conditions, and concurrent medications can impact its effectiveness and safety. As with any supplement, it’s advisable to consult with a healthcare professional before initiating melatonin therapy, particularly if you have existing medical concerns or are taking other medications.

Here are the top 3 questions I get about melatonin:

1️⃣ Should I take regular or timed-release melatonin?

If you struggle to FALL asleep, you’ll want to take regular melatonin for the fastest action. If you struggle to STAY asleep, timed-release is best. 

2️⃣ Should I take capsules, tablets, or a liquid?

If you want the fastest action to support sleep onset, it’s best to choose a liquid or a sublingual tablet. That way the melatonin can absorb directly into the capillaries under the tongue for the quickest effect. 

3️⃣ How much should I take? 

The optimal amount depends on your individual response as well as the reason you are taking melatonin (lower amounts support sleep whereas higher amounts support immune function). It’s best to talk with a healthcare professional!
